Output e156eec5b4da15eb0f6f1b08d173a763f4c2093bb0a181fe81a186f84f85af52:4

value
1040365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5841513e2fac4dbedf4514206173af2e84943416 OP_EQUAL
address
39jfdkhUZrFMRgRwMRSSJDkbjDFoMspQpK
transaction
e156eec5b4da15eb0f6f1b08d173a763f4c2093bb0a181fe81a186f84f85af52
spent
true